SHORTBREAD WITH PISTACHIO AND NUTELLA, filled biscuits with double filling, quick and easy, soft shortbread made with simple pastry and filled with Nutella and pistachio cream.
Very simple and tasty, the shortbread with pistachio and Nutella, are filled biscuits great to serve both for breakfast and snack, ideal for dunking in milk, they melt in your mouth.
The recipe for shortbread with pistachio and Nutella is very simple, the pastry is rolled out, cut, and filled with the two creams, a real treat that I’m sure you’ll love too.

- Difficulty: Very easy
- Cost: Very cheap
- Rest time: 30 Minutes
- Preparation time: 15 Minutes
- Portions: 4-5
- Cooking methods: Oven
- Cuisine: Italian
Ingredients
- 1.5 cups all-purpose flour
- 7 tbsps butter
- 1 egg
- 1/3 cup sugar
- 2 tbsps Nutella®
- 2 tbsps pistachio cream
Preparation
Prepare the shortcrust pastry; pour the flour into a bowl or mixer, add the sugar, egg, and butter.
Knead well, then let the pastry rest in plastic wrap and put it in the fridge for 30 minutes.
After the time has passed, take the pastry and roll it out on a floured work surface to a thickness of about 1/8 inch.
Cut it with a glass or a 2-inch cutter, fill half of the discs with a teaspoon of Nutella and a teaspoon of pistachio cream.
Close with the other half of the discs and seal the edges by folding them underneath, add pistachio crumbs then place the shortbread on the ba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
Bake in a hot oven at 350°F and bake for 15 minutes.
